One of three Southern Region “Schools Class” CHELTENHAM at Ropley 25th Oct 2014
Built at Eastleigh in 1934, withdrawn in 1962 and now part of the National Collection
40 built & designed by Richard Maunsell and the last 4-4-0 design in the UK and the most powerful 4-4-0 in Europe.
Driving wheels 6’ 7” in diameter, loco 67 tons, tender 42 tons.
Boiler pressure 220psi, tractive effort 25,130 lbf
